Write the equation of the line in slope-intercept form that has a slope of -4 and passes through the point (-1, -3).

Answer:
y= -4x -7
Explanation:
Slope=-4
Coordinates= (-1,-3)
Y=mx+b
-3=-4(-1)+b
-3=4+b
-4 -4
-7=b
